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4
The NM_022034.6(CUZD1):c.814A>C(p.Thr272Pro)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000106 in 1,606,122 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.814A>C (p.T272P) alteration is located in exon 5 (coding exon 5) of the CUZD1 gene. This alteration results from a A to C substitution at nucleotide position 814, causing the threonine (T) at amino acid position 272 to be replaced by a proline (P).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
